Well THIS is a real peach! This is an excellent condition Civil War revolver, made by the MANHATTAN FIREARMS COMPANY of NEWARK, N. J., and is definitely one of the best examples we have seen! The company was originally founded in 1856, mainly to make Colt style revolvers once their patent ran out in 1857.
